WebMay 20, 2024 · TIP: When placing lights, draw a reference line of where you would like the light to be and hit. 1st click: This will determine the base point for the light. Click on the surface or axis of the object you would like the light to be placed. 2nd click: This will determine where the light will be placed on the surface. WebClick 2: Place the light source. Move the mouse again to select the surface or axis off which the placement of the light target is based of. Click 3: Pick Spot light target placement surface / axis. Once you have clicked to select the face or axis, move your mouse to finally select the actual light target. The V-Ray Spot Light is a V-Ray specific light source plugin that can be used to create physically accurate area lights. It produces a focused light, which is targeted towards an object in the scene.
